Hi, Currently siddhi only identifies option parameter values defined only with a place holder. But it does not identifies option parameters as dynamic if the place holder is placed in the middle of a string. [1]
For example : *@sink(type='file', uri={{symbol}}'* In this case, *uri* will be identified as a dynamic option. *@sink(type='file', uri='/abc/{{symbol}}.json* In this case, *uri* will not be taken as a dynamic parameter even we have registered as a supported dynamic option. I have made a fix for this issue, but need to confirm it won't be an issue for other implementations. Shall we accept both above types of values as dynamic options?
